How to repaint coloring wallpapers?

Coloring wallpaper repainting is a simple process that can restore the look of the room without the need to do extensive repairs. Take these steps to achieve a smooth and professional finish:

Required materials and tools:
Painting tape (paper adhesive tape)
Sandpaper (fine)
Cloth
Detergent
Bucket with water
Primer (if necessary)
Color (latex or acrylic)
Color pad
Painting rollers (with an extended handle)
Painting brushes
Mixing stick
Stairs (if necessary)

Preparation:
Move furniture: Release the room or move the furniture to the center and cover them with a film.
With the dye tape, enclose the surface where you do not want to paint. Place the construction film to protect the floor.


Clean the wallpapers:
Clean the wallpaper with a dry cloth. Then clean them with a sponge or cloth moistened with a lightweight detergent and water. Thus, remove any dirt or greasy trauma, which could interfere with the color of the color properly.
Clean the wallpaper with a moistened rag to remove soap residues. Let the wallpaper dry completely.

Priming (if necessary):
Bottom application: Use a roller for large areas and a brush for corners and edges. Allow the primer to dry according to the manufacturer's instructions.


Painting:
Stir the paint thoroughly with a mixing stick.
Start painting the edges and corners with the brush, as well as hard -to -reach areas.
Apply paint on a roll: Apply the paint to larger walls with a roller. Apply paint to smooth strokes using "W" or "M" movements to avoid lines and provide a smooth coating.
Several coatings: Depending on the color and wallpaper texture, more than one coating may be required. Allow the first layer to dry completely before applying the extra layers.

Remove the dye tape: To avoid peeling the paint, carefully remove the dye tape before the paint is completely dried.
If you noticed that you run and paint somewhere, take the brush with color and paint these fragments.
Clean the brushes and rolls according to the color manufacturer's instructions. Get rid of all waste properly.


Drying:
Ventilation: To prevent steam and moisture, provide ventilation during paint drying - open the door in the room. Do not create drafts or open windows during drying! Do not use devices that affect moisture in the room: i.e. Air heaters, air conditioners or air dryers!
Before moving the furniture back, let the paint dry completely.
By following these steps, you can successfully repaint coloring wallpapers and give the room a new look.
